Output 45dffe77ad072c8c010b2380f5768e799eee6df9e87d7d3fc2d6904daa16dd53:0

value
500000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7de18b34a3aff75535e573615ec981b1c365c12b OP_EQUAL
address
3DAcaaWYWLrLTb6iMMYL4iqZnqpBkWviaD
transaction
45dffe77ad072c8c010b2380f5768e799eee6df9e87d7d3fc2d6904daa16dd53
confirmations
255479
spent
true